Multiresolution and multimaterial topology optimization of fail-safe structures under B-spline spaces

Frontiers of Mechanical Engineering 2023, Volume 18, Issue 4, doi: 10.1007/s11465-023-0768-9

Abstract: This study proposes a B-spline-based multiresolution and multimaterial topology optimization (TO) design method for fail-safe structures (FSSs), aiming to achieve efficient and lightweight structural design while ensuring safety and facilitating the postprocessing of topological structures. The approach involves constructing a multimaterial interpolation model based on an ordered solid isotropic material with penalization (ordered-SIMP) that incorporates fail-safe considerations. To reduce the computational burden of finite element analysis, we adopt a much coarser analysis mesh and finer density mesh to discretize the design domain, in which the density field is described by the B-spline function. The B-spline can efficiently and accurately convert optimized FSSs into computer-aided design models. The 2D and 3D numerical examples demonstrate the significantly enhanced computational efficiency of the proposed method compared with the traditional SIMP approach, and the multimaterial TO provides a superior structural design scheme for FSSs. Furthermore, the postprocessing procedures are significantly streamlined.

Study on Strategies for Developing Offshore as the New Spaces for Mariculture in China

Mai Kangsen,Xu Hao,Xue Changhu,Gu Weidong,Zhang Wenbing,Li Zhaojie and Yu Bo

Strategic Study of CAE 2016, Volume 18, Issue 3,   Pages 90-95 doi: 10.15302/J-SSCAE-2016.03.015

Abstract:

Mariculture industry, makes great contribution to national food security, economy and trade balance. To realize sustainable development of mariculture in China in the new period, it is urgent to exploit new space and develop offshore aquaculture strategy. Offshore aquaculture is an integrated system including suitable species, culture techniques, culture equipments, energy supply, sea-land relay logistics, aquatic products processing, and strategies of disaster prevention and reduction. On the basis of a strategic concept of the new space for mariculture in China, the present study puts forward strategic missions on the development of offshore mariculture. The missions include building a suitable species breeding and efficient farming technology system, constructing a new type of marine fisheries production mode with the core of offshore aquaculture platform, building an energy security system, and constructing an intelligent mariculture products logistics network. Based on these strategies, relevant policy suggestions are also suggested.
